개발에 AtoZ까지

[JAVA][D1] 2050. 알파벳을 숫자로 변환 본문

코딩테스트 준비/SWEA

[JAVA][D1] 2050. 알파벳을 숫자로 변환

AtoZ 개발자 2021. 1. 4. 18:27
반응형

문제 

알파벳으로 이루어진 문자열을 입력 받아 각 알파벳을 1부터 26까지의 숫자로 변환하여 출력하라.


[제약 사항]

문자열의 최대 길이는 200이다.


[입력]

알파벳으로 이루어진 문자열이 주어진다.


[출력]

각 알파벳을 숫자로 변환한 결과값을 빈 칸을 두고 출력한다.

예시

 

풀이

import java.io.BufferedReader;
import java.io.InputStreamReader;

public class Solution {
	public static void main(String[] args) {
		BufferedReader br = new BufferedReader(new InputStreamReader(System.in));
		try {
			//입력된 문자 자르기
			String str= br.readLine();
			for(int i=0;i<str.length();i++) {
				//65 ='A'인것을 활용하여 품
				System.out.printf("%d ",(int)str.charAt(i)-64);
			}
			} catch (Exception e) {
			e.printStackTrace();
		}
	}

}
반응형
Comments